THE chief of the Senate mass media committee is keen on probing the reported possible violation of press freedom in the indefinite suspension of Sonshine Media Network International of embattled Pastor Apollo Quiboloy.
“The imposition of baseless suspension orders on SMNI not only constitutes a denial of due process but also an erosion of press freedom,” Padilla said in Senate Resolution 1000, which directs the Committee on Public Information and Mass Media – which he chairs – to conduct the inquiry.
